UniProtAcc | . | Q03113 Main function of 5'-partner protein: FUNCTION: Guanine nucleotide-binding proteins (G proteins) are involved as modulators or transducers in various transmembrane signaling systems (PubMed:22609986, PubMed:15525651, PubMed:15240885, PubMed:17565996, PubMed:12515866, PubMed:16787920, PubMed:16705036, PubMed:23762476, PubMed:27084452). Activates effector molecule RhoA by binding and activating RhoGEFs (ARHGEF12/LARG) (PubMed:15240885, PubMed:12515866, PubMed:16202387). GNA12-dependent Rho signaling subsequently regulates transcription factor AP-1 (activating protein-1) (By similarity). GNA12-dependent Rho signaling also regulates protein phosphatese 2A activation causing dephosphorylation of its target proteins (PubMed:15525651, PubMed:17565996). Promotes tumor cell invasion and metastasis by activating RhoA/ROCK signaling pathway and up-regulating proinflammatory cytokine production (PubMed:23762476, PubMed:16787920, PubMed:16705036, PubMed:27084452). Inhibits CDH1-mediated cell adhesion in process independent from Rho activation (PubMed:11976333, PubMed:16787920). Together with NAPA promotes CDH5 localization to plasma membrane (PubMed:15980433). May play a role in the control of cell migration through the TOR signaling cascade (PubMed:22609986). {ECO:0000250|UniProtKB:P27600, ECO:0000269|PubMed:11976333, ECO:0000269|PubMed:12515866, ECO:0000269|PubMed:15240885, ECO:0000269|PubMed:15525651, ECO:0000269|PubMed:15980433, ECO:0000269|PubMed:16705036, ECO:0000269|PubMed:16787920, ECO:0000269|PubMed:17565996, ECO:0000269|PubMed:22609986, ECO:0000269|PubMed:23762476, ECO:0000269|PubMed:27084452}. | |
